Job Summary
The Sharepoint developer will be part of a small but dynamic team that develops SharePoint solutions across the customer space. Day to Day duties include gathering requirements from customers, building out custom lists, libraries, and workflows, and testing SharePoint solutions with the customer to ensure solution is error free before deployment. Must be able to Identify, analyze, and correct active and impending problems with SharePoint and support usage of SharePoint by creating accounts, modifying configuration files, or performing whatever actions are needed to allow users and processes to be given access to the product or to be removed from access.
